According to the Upanishads, this body is not impure. The so-called religious people are full of a deep condemnation for the body – as if the body is evil, something to be hated; as if the body is the cause of all the unhappiness, the misery, the bondage in life. For them it is as if the body is the gate to hell. But this so-called religious concept has no foundation: only the sick-minded think like this.

The body is not binding you, it is not holding you. How can it hold you? It is you who are holding the body. You have chosen this body: it is the manifested form of all your desires and longings. So the first thing to be understood is that whatever body you have, whether it is human or animal, bird or tree or stone, whether it is of a woman or a man, beautiful or ugly, healthy or sick – whatever body you have – it is the manifestation of your desires, your passions, your longings. You have exactly what you have desired. But you cannot see this because there is a great distance of time between the desire and its fulfillment.

A man sows a seed and after many years it sprouts. In the meantime, he has totally forgotten that he had sown the seed. You will be surprised to know that there were many tribes around the world, and even today there are some African tribes, that don’t know that a child is born out of sexual intercourse because months have passed since the intercourse took place and here, now the child is born. So many tribes could not understand this connection. And each sexual intercourse does not create a child. Out of hundreds one results in the birth of a child and that too takes nine months.

Sometimes it takes a very long time to see the fulfillment of your desires, longings and wishes: you yourself have forgotten that you had desired it. Psychologists say that you invite many diseases: at some time you have desired them and that desire has remained suppressed in your unconscious mind. Then gradually the body creates that disease. It will be a little difficult to understand it because nobody likes sickness. Then why would someone desire to be sick? Why would someone sow the seeds of illness? There are profound reasons for this in the life of a person and it is a very complex network.

Whenever a small child becomes ill, people give him much attention and they care for him. When he is well nobody pays any attention to him. So in his unconscious mind it becomes clear that it is to his advantage to be ill because only then people will pay attention to him.

Everyone wants attention. It is a deep longing that people should pay attention to you because attention is food. Whenever someone looks at you you feel nourished and you become sad when nobody looks at you. Slowly, slowly a small child experiences that whenever he is ill something important happens – his father gives him more love and his mother sits near him. He has always wanted his father to be more loving towards him, for his mother to sit with him and everyone to care about him, but nobody ever bothered about him. But all his wishes are fulfilled when he is ill. Then his longing for attention becomes connected with illness. Later on, after many years, whenever this person feels neglected by others his unconscious desire to be ill will become very strong. This desire will not be conscious, it will be deep in his unconscious mind.
